Ingredients for 4th of July Rice Krispie Treats
Here’s what you’ll need to make this delicious dish:
- Rice Krispies Cereal: The star ingredient that provides that satisfying crunch; choose the classic for best results.
- Marshmallows: Mini marshmallows work best for even melting and gooeyness; look for fresh ones for optimal fluffiness.
- Butter: Unsalted butter adds richness; it helps bind everything together while adding flavor.
- Food Coloring (Red and Blue): Gel food coloring gives vibrant hues without altering the texture—perfect for festive flair!
- Sprinkles: Red, white, and blue sprinkles add that extra pop of patriotism and make everything look adorable.

How to Make 4th of July Rice Krispie Treats
Follow these simple steps to prepare this delicious dish:
Step 1: Gather Your Tools
First things first: grab a large mixing bowl and a saucepan. You’ll also want a spatula or wooden spoon for mixing later on.
Step 2: Melt the Butter
In your saucepan over low heat, melt the butter completely. Keep an eye on it so it doesn’t burn—it’s not a good look!
Step 3: Add Marshmallows
Once melted, toss in the mini marshmallows and stir continuously until they melt into a gooey blob of goodness resembling clouds on a summer day.
Step 4: Mix in Cereal
Remove from heat and fold in the Rice Krispies cereal gently but thoroughly until every piece is covered in that delightful marshmallow mixture.
Step 5: Color It Up
Divide your mixture into two bowls. Add red food coloring to one bowl and blue to another. Mix until you achieve vibrant colors that would make any flag proud!
Step 6: Layer and Cool
In a greased baking dish, press down half of the red mixture first, followed by half of the blue mixture on top. Repeat with remaining mixtures to create layers! Let it cool before cutting into squares.

How do you store 4th of July Rice Krispie Treats?
To keep your 4th of July Rice Krispie Treats fresh, store them in an airtight container at room temperature. Avoid refrigerating them, as this can make the treats hard. If properly stored, they can last for about three days. For longer storage, consider wrapping individual pieces in plastic wrap and placing them in a freezer-safe bag. This way, you can enjoy the treats even after the holiday.

4th of July Rice Krispie Treats
4th of July Rice Krispie Treats are a delightful and festive twist on a classic dessert, perfect for celebrating Independence Day. These colorful treats combine crispy Rice Krispies cereal, gooey mini marshmallows, and rich butter, creating a sweet and crunchy experience that will bring joy to your summer gatherings. With vibrant red, white, and blue layers, they not only taste amazing but also make for an eye-catching centerpiece at any celebration. Easy to make and customizable, these treats are sure to be a hit at your 4th of July festivities.
- Prep Time: 10 minutes
- Cook Time: 5 minutes
- Total Time: 15 minutes
- Yield: Approximately 12 servings 1x
- Category: Dessert
- Method: Baking
- Cuisine: American
Ingredients
- 6 cups Rice Krispies cereal
- 10 oz mini marshmallows
- 4 tbsp unsalted butter
- 1 tsp red gel food coloring
- 1 tsp blue gel food coloring
- ¼ cup red, white, and blue sprinkles
Instructions
- In a saucepan over low heat, melt the butter completely.
- Add mini marshmallows and stir until fully melted.
- Remove from heat and fold in the Rice Krispies until evenly coated.
- Divide the mixture into two bowls; add red food coloring to one bowl and blue to the other, mixing well.
- Grease a baking dish and layer half of the red mixture followed by half of the blue mixture. Repeat with remaining mixtures.
- Press down firmly to compact layers and let cool before cutting into squares.
